When should I book my B&B in Warsaw?
When you're dreaming of a stay in Warsaw, make sure that you take the year-round temperatures into account. The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 23°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 3°C. Average annual precipitation for Warsaw is 1251 mm.

How can I get to and around Warsaw?
You can plan your excursions in and around Warsaw ahead of time with these transportation options. Fly into Cincinnati-Northern Kentucky Int'l Airport (CVG), which is located 22.9 mi (36.9 km) from the heart of the city. Otherwise, you can search for flights to Cincinnati, OH (LUK-Cincinnati Municipal - Lunken Field), which is 33.7 mi (54.2 km) away.
